243 👽 UAP MEGA-THREAD 🛸 posted 2 years ago by DonSpectacularis 2 years ago by DonSpectacularis +248 / -5 335 comments share 335 comments share save hide report block hide replies
Does anyone really believe that Humans are the best that God could do???